Abstract
Acrylic copolymer systems consisting of methyl methacrylate and triethylene glycol dimethacrylate with different chemical compositions were synthesize d through bulk polymerization using N,N-dimethyl-p-toluidine as an acelerat or to obtain nonshrinkable polymers. The use of the tertiary amine on this formulation produces an increase on the volume of the material due to a pha se separation in the copolymer, which compensates the volume reduction upon curing. The specific volumes of all materials were determined by volume di latometry using a dilatometer specially constructed for this purpose. (C) 2 000 John Wiley & Sons, Inc.
